Meson cloud effects on the pion quark distribution function in the chiral constituent quark model
Abstract
We investigate the valence quark distribution function of the pion $v^{\pi}(x,Q^2)$ in the framework of the chiral constituent quark model and evaluate the meson cloud effects on $v^{\pi}(x,Q^2)$. We explicitly demonstrate how the meson cloud effects affect $v^{\pi}(x,Q^2)$ in detail. We find that the meson cloud correction causes an overall 32\% reduction of the valence quark distribution and an enhancement at the small Bjorken $x$ regime. Besides, we also find that the dressing effect of the meson cloud will make the valence quark distribution to be softer in the large $x$ region.
